Viking: Battle For Asgard

Immerse yourself in Norse mythology as Skarin, a fearsome Viking warrior fated to defend mankind and discover the secrets of his past...

LONDON & SAN FRANCISCO (August 21st 2007) - SEGA® Europe Ltd and SEGA® of America, Inc. today announced Viking: Battle For Asgard™, the latest console title from the award winning and critically acclaimed development studio, The Creative Assembly. As Skarin, a new iconic gaming hero, experience the violent yet spectacular world of the Vikings and their Gods on the Xbox 360™ video game and entertainment system from Microsoft and the Sony PlayStation® 3 computer entertainment system, early in 2008.

A fierce struggle is taking place within the realm of the Norse Gods. The Goddess Hel has been banished for defying Odin, Lord of Asgard. Angry at her fate, Hel has raised an army of undead warriors to enslave the mortal realm of Midgard, and then provoke Ragnarok - the apocalyptic battle that that will destroy Asgard and the Gods themselves. The task of stopping Hel and defending the future of mankind falls to Skarin, a promising but deeply flawed young warrior, ignorant of the true reason for his favour with the Gods…

Leave a bloody trail of dismembered foes as you master an involving and addictive combat style with destructive mythical powers and abilities. Explore vast and visually stunning open-world environments whilst slaying your enemies with a huge array of devastating and brutal combat moves. Tame mighty dragons and unleash their rain of fire, laying waste to the enemy hordes that stand in your way. Free enslaved warriors to wage war on Hel’s legion and lead them into huge, epic battles featuring colossal giants, powerful shaman, deadly assassins and Hel’s own champions. Here players can use Skarin’s emerging skills to help turn the tide of conflict with a timely murder or through the brutality of a visceral wave of slaughter.

“Skarin is a cutting edge hero in a fantastic re-imagining of Norse Mythology. Skarin is obviously a very dangerous man.” said Gary Knight, European Marketing Director SEGA Europe. “Add in his inner conflict, a confused heritage and a growing distrust of the Gods and you have the makings of gaming’s next great hero.”

Viking: Battle For Asgard™ is due for release on Xbox 360™ and PlayStation® 3 early in 2008.
